Is Espro Press dishwasher safe?

The ESPRO Press is completely dishwasher safe (just put the filters on the upper rack).

How big a French press do I need?

A 12 cup press will probably be way more press than you really need, but a 3 cup press will limit you with the smaller capacity. That’s why the 8 cup press is the standard size that most people buy.

What is the coffee water ratio for a French press?

French press coffee calls for a coarse, even grind. We recommend starting with a 1:12 coffee-to-water ratio. If you’re using 350 grams of water, you’ll want 30 grams of coffee. To start, gently pour twice the amount of water than you have coffee onto your grounds.

Is Espro a Canadian company?

Espro is a Canadian company who loves taking traditional coffee equipment and making it better.

Is the Espro P7 stainless steel French press hot?

A huge complaint with glass french presses is that even though they look beautiful sitting on the countertop, they don’t hold heat for a long enough amount of time. The Espro P7 easily solves this problem and keeps your freshly brewed coffee hot all morning long.
